CareDx (CDNA), a leading precision medicine company focused on transplant diagnostics, delivered a strong performance in the first quarter of 2026, exceeding market expectations on both revenue and earnings per share metrics. The company reported revenue of $379.8 million, reflecting solid demand across its transplant testing portfolio and growing momentum in its organ care business segment. Management Commentary
CareDx leadership expressed confidence in the company's positioning within the rapidly evolving transplant care ecosystem. The executive team highlighted that demand for precision transplant monitoring solutions remained robust, with healthcare providers increasingly recognizing the value of molecular diagnostics in managing post-transplant patients. The company's sales force expansion initiatives, implemented in recent quarters, began yielding measurable results during Q1 2026.
Management discussed significant progress in integrating the organ care platform, which complements the company's existing diagnostic offerings by providing end-to-end solutions for transplant centers. This strategic expansion positions CareDx to serve as a comprehensive partner to transplant programs, potentially driving deeper customer relationships and recurring revenue streams. The leadership team acknowledged challenges in the broader healthcare operating environment, including ongoing reimbursement complexities and healthcare system capacity constraints, while noting that CareDx's differentiated value proposition helped mitigate these headwinds.

Forward Guidance
Looking ahead, CareDx management provided optimistic commentary regarding the company's growth prospects for the remainder of 2026. The company indicated that it anticipates continued momentum in its diagnostic testing business, supported by expanding payer coverage decisions and increased physician awareness of molecular testing benefits in transplant patient management. The organ care segment is expected to contribute increasingly to consolidated results as integration activities mature and distribution channels expand.
Management noted that investment in the development pipeline remains a strategic priority, with several initiatives targeting adjacent transplant market opportunities. The company expects to maintain disciplined expense management while supporting growth investments that could drive long-term shareholder value. Cash generation capabilities appeared strong during the quarter, providing financial flexibility to pursue both organic growth initiatives and potential strategic acquisitions that align with CareDx's precision medicine vision.

Market Reaction
Market participants responded positively to CareDx's Q1 2026 results, with shares trading higher in the session following the earnings release. Analysts highlighted the company's ability to deliver results ahead of consensus expectations as evidence of execution strength and market expansion progress. The quarterly performance appeared to address concerns about competitive pressures in the transplant diagnostics space, demonstrating CareDx's continued leadership position.
Industry observers noted the strategic significance of the organ care expansion, viewing it as a meaningful catalyst for revenue diversification and long-term growth acceleration. Analyst reports following the release emphasized CareDx's comprehensive transplant care platform as potentially transformative, though some noted the need for continued monitoring of integration execution and reimbursement developments. The company's profitability trajectory and improving operating metrics attracted attention from investors seeking exposure to precision medicine themes within the diagnostics subsector.
